Телефон: 8-800-350-22-65
WhatsApp: 8-800-350-22-65
Telegram: sibac
Прием заявок круглосуточно
График работы офиса: с 9.00 до 18.00 Нск (5.00 - 14.00 Мск)

Статья опубликована в рамках: XXXVIII Международной научно-практической конференции «Научное сообщество студентов XXI столетия. ТЕХНИЧЕСКИЕ НАУКИ» (Россия, г. Новосибирск, 26 января 2016 г.)

Наука: Информационные технологии

Скачать книгу(-и): Сборник статей конференции

Библиографическое описание:
Вериго Л.В., Авакян Т.А. 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 «МЕНЕДЖЕР ПО ПРОДАЖАМ КОМПЬЮТЕРНОЙ ТЕХНИКИ» В СРЕДЕ MICROSOFT VISUAL STUDIO // Научное сообщество студентов XXI столетия. ТЕХНИЧЕСКИЕ НАУКИ: сб. ст. по мат. XXXVIII междунар. студ. науч.-практ. конф. № 1(37). URL: http://sibac.info/archive/technic/1(37).pdf (дата обращения: 04.05.2024)
Проголосовать за статью
Конференция завершена
Эта статья набрала 0 голосов
Дипломы участников
У данной статьи нет
дипломов

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 «МЕНЕДЖЕР ПО ПРОДАЖАМ КОМПЬЮТЕРНОЙ ТЕХНИКИ» В СРЕДЕ MICROSOFT VISUAL STUDIO

Вериго Людмила Витальевна

студент 3 курса, кафедра АСОУ МТУ, филиал МИРЭА, г. Ставрополь

E-mail:

Авакян Тамара Ашотовна

доцент, кафедра АСОУ МТУ, филиал МИРЭА, г. Ставрополь

 

Процесс проектирование БД подразумевает создание базы данных, обеспечивающей хранение и обработку всей необходимой пользователю информации, и подразделяется на следующие этапы:

1. Системный анализ ПО.

2. Инфологическое (концептуальное) проектирование.

3. Выбор СУБД.

4. Даталогическое (логическое) проектирование.

5. Физическое проектирование [1].

Для изучения особенностей проектирования базы данных и реализации, необходимых для ее корректной работы функций рассмотрена предметная область "Менеджер по продажам компьютерной техники". Менеджер по продажам осуществляет связь между покупателями, торговыми и производящими организациями, является лицом, ответственным за организацию, ведение и обеспечение продаж, планирование и аналитическую работу. Профессия широко распространена в сфере оптовой торговли.

Автоматизация работы менеджера, то есть проектирование приложения для работы с БД, осуществлена с помощью среды Microsoft Visual Studio.

Microsoft Visual Studio – средство для разработчиков ПО, которое позволяет решать основные задачи разработки: система упрощает создание, отладку и развёртывание приложений на различных платформах. Основными преимуществами Visual Studio являются:

- использование вычислительных мощностей локального компьютера и облака;

- простая реализация общих задач и индивидуальный подход;

- быстрое создание высококачественного кода;

- функция поддержки нескольких мониторов;

- реализация идей и решений для широкого спектра платформ, включая Windows, Windows Server, веб-среду, облачную среду, Office и SharePoint [3].

Базы данных представляет собой набор связанных с помощью внешних и первичных ключей таблиц. Она реализована в интегрированной среде Microsoft SQL Server 2012. Ее структура представлена на рисунке 1:

Рисунок 1 – Схема базы данных

 

Подключение базы данных к создаваемому приложению для последующей работы с данными осуществляется посредством создания нового подключения в обозревателе серверов, интегрированном в среду Microsoft Visual Studio. После этой процедуры данные в таблицах будут доступны для манипулирования в самой среде программирования. Манипулирование можно осуществить, применив сначала компонент «SqlDataAdapter», который обеспечивает взаимодействие с базой данных, а затем компонент «DataSet», используемый для доступа и хранения данных, полученных от источника данных в результате выполнения SQL-запросов. Элемент «DataSet» позволяет создавать таблицы данных, задавать первичные ключи и свойства столбцов [2]. Его свойства представлены ниже:

Рисунок 2 – Настройка компонента «DataSet»

 

Интерфейс программы разделен на две части: в первой части находятся таблицы, используемые для просмотра данных, добавления, редактирования и удаления, во второй части происходит поиск информации. Для вывода данных в программе используется элемент «DataGridView», отображающий информацию в табличной форме. Доступ к нужной информации реализуется через выбор типа выводимых данных, а затем выбор нужной таблицы, после чего она автоматически отображается в форме, что указано на рисунке 3:

Рисунок 3 – Вывод таблиц

 

Поиск данных осуществляется с помощью запросов, написанных на языке SQL. Запрос для выбора данных из таблицы «Память» представлен на листинге 1:

Листинг 1 – Запрос поиска данных в таблице «Память»

SELECT [Код памяти], Название, Тип, Объем, Частота

FROM Память

WHERE (LOWER(Название) LIKE LOWER(@1)) AND

      (LOWER(Тип) LIKE LOWER(@2)) AND

      (CAST(Объем AS varchar(50)) LIKE @3) AND

      (CAST(Частота AS varchar(50)) LIKE @4)

Выполнение запроса состоит в отборе значений, соответствующих заданным условиям поиска. Реализация запроса представлена на рисунке 4:

Рисунок 4 – Поиск товара по названию

 

Так как программа ориентирована на менеджера по продажам, а соответственно на регистрацию продаж и поставок товара, то для удобства просмотра информации по каждой из этих двух категорий реализована возможность создания отчетов.

Отчет по продажам, как и отчет по поставкам, может быть отсортирован по наименованию товара, инициалам клиента, дате продажи или поставки.

Для формирования отчета по количеству проданных ноутбуков Asus было разработано средство по созданию отчетов, выбор отображаемых полей которого представлен на рисунке 5:

Рисунок 5 – Формирование отчета

Созданный отчет сохраняется в файл с расширением html и выводится в окно браузера следующим образом:

Рисунок 6 – Отчет по продажам

 

Дополнительной функцией отчета является подсчет общей стоимости купленного одним клиентом товара, а также подсчет стоимости всех товаров, купленных всеми клиентами. Суммарная стоимость выводится отдельной ячейкой в таблице.

Данный отчет можно использовать в дальнейшем для его анализа. Аналогично создается отчет по поставкам товара.

Программа «Менеджер по продажам компьютерной техники» спроектирована и реализована с целью обеспечения автоматизации работы менеджера по продажам, упрощения взаимодействия с поставщиками и клиентами, а также с товаром и информацией о нем.

 

Список литературы:

  1. Авакян Т.А. Курс лекций по дисциплине «Базы данных», 2015.
  2. Хомоненко А.Д. Базы данных [Текст]: учебник для высших учебных заведений / А.Д. Хомоненко, В.М. Цыганков, М. Г. Мальцев. – 6-е изд. доп. – М.: (ГРИФ) КОРОНА-Век, 2010. – 736 с.
  3. Microsoft Visual Studio. – 2004. – [электронный ресурс] – URL: https://www.microsoft.com/rus/business/smb/products-list/visualstudio2010/ (дата обращения: 15.01.2016)
Проголосовать за статью
Конференция завершена
Эта статья набрала 0 голосов
Дипломы участников
У данной статьи нет
дипломов

Оставить комментарий

Форма обратной связи о взаимодействии с сайтом
CAPTCHA
Этот вопрос задается для того, чтобы выяснить, являетесь ли Вы человеком или представляете из себя автоматическую спам-рассылку.